Nike Air Revolution High – Black/Black/White

Nike Air Revolution High – Black/Black/White

We just gave you a look at the Nike Air Burst in White/Black-Carrot and now we have the Air Revolution High that looks to be a part of the same basic color pack. The Air Revolution High uses the same outsole as the Jordan IV which is arguably the most popular Jordan model of all time thus making the Revolution a hit for some sneakerheads while others may argue that the cut is a little too high for their liking especially during the Spring/Summer months. None the less it’s good to see Nike putting out classic shoes such as the Burst and Revolution in simple colorways that average consumers can appreciate in addition to sneakerheads. via LTD OnlineStyle: 303905-002
Color: Black/Black-White
